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Union Pacific Corporation executive vice president and chief financial officer Jennifer L. Hamann reported a charitable stock gift in a Form 4 filing. On 12/04/2025, she donated 300 shares of Union Pacific common stock, recorded with a transaction code G (gift) at a price of $0.0 per share, reflecting that it was not a sale for value. After this transaction, she beneficially owned 108,841.8976 shares directly and 5,621.328 shares indirectly through a deferral account. The filing notes that the contribution was made to a non-affiliated entity, indicating it was an external charitable organization.
